Round 15 team: Liu to debut as Titans head to Tiger town

Emerging forward Jett Liu will make his NRL debut against the Wests Tigers as the Titans aim to continue their good form on Sunday afternoon at the eighth wonder of the world.

One of three forced changes due to Origin duties and injury, the 22-year-old will embark on Leichhardt Oval for his maiden appearance after moving from the Dragons to join Gold Coast this season - recently upgraded to the squad's top 30 after initially signing as a development player.

Named on the interchange, he is one of the fresh faces in Josh Hannay's side with Jaylan De Groot promoted to starting centre to fill the void left by Jojo Fifita, who is in Camp Maroon alongside co-captain Tino Fa'asuamaleaui.

Klese Haas joins fellow skipper Moeaki Fotuaika up front; whilst Adam Christensen has earnt a recall to NRL following a strong few weeks in the Hostplus Cup, set to play his second first grade game from the bench.

Kick-off is at 4.05pm on Sunday at Leichhardt Oval, Sydney.
